## Abstract In this paper, we show that every 3βconnected clawβfree graph on n vertices with Ξ΄ β₯ (__n__ + 5)/5 is hamiltonian. Β© 1993 John Wiley & Sons, Inc.
## Abstract M. Matthews and D. Sumner have proved that of __G__ is a 2βconnected clawβfree graph of order __n__ such that Ξ΄ β§ (__n__ β 2)/3, then __G__ is hamiltonian. ## Abstract One of the most fundamental results concerning paths in graphs is due to Ore: In a graph __G__, if deg __x__ + deg __y__ β§ |__V__(__G__)| + 1 for all pairs of nonadjacent vertices __x, y__ β __V__(__G__), then __G__ is hamiltonianβconnected. We generalize this result using set degrees.
